Parents and teachers should prioritize reading comprehension and subtraction for 5-year-olds because these fundamental skills are crucial during early childhood development. At this stage, children’s brains are highly receptive to learning, and establishing solid foundations in both literacy and numeracy paves the way for future academic success.

Reading comprehension involves not just the ability to read text, but also to understand and engage with it meaningfully. By fostering comprehension skills, we help children develop critical thinking, vocabulary, and communication abilities essential for all areas of learning. Strong reading comprehension skills enable children to follow instructions, understand stories, and acquire new information with greater ease.

Subtraction, a basic arithmetic skill, is equally important as it forms the basis for more advanced mathematical concepts. Mastery of subtraction helps children develop problem-solving skills and logical thinking. At this tender age, incorporating number games, visual aids, and real-world examples makes learning subtraction enjoyable and tangible.

By integrating reading comprehension and subtraction, parents and teachers equip children with versatile tools for intellectual growth. A solid grasp on these skills boosts confidence, laying down a track for a lifelong positive attitude towards learning. Additionally, the excitement generated by mastering these skills can instill a love for both math and reading that will benefit children throughout their education.
